Where's the Blob Brush?

I am learning how to use Illustrator and while doing a tutorial I was told to select the blob brush. I cannot find this brush anywhere in my brush library and it is not in my brush panel. I've tried googling where to find it and have been unable to locate it. How do I get this brush?

Correct answer Barb Binder

What version are you using? The Blob brush was new in CS5, I believe. Assuming you are not on CS4 or earlier, it lives with the Paintbrush tool. Tap Shift B or press and hold on the Paintbrush tool to access it.
